A printed or digital sheet featuring line art depictions of prehistoric creatures, suitable for coloring, provides an engaging activity. These illustrations often present images of dinosaurs, early mammals, and other extinct fauna, allowing individuals to apply color creatively within the provided outlines. For example, a user might encounter a Triceratops outline and choose to color it with hues based on scientific speculation or personal artistic preference.
Such activities offer multiple benefits, including fostering artistic expression and developing fine motor skills. Furthermore, they can serve as accessible educational tools, introducing learners to paleontology and the diversity of life that existed in past geological eras. These sheets, therefore, connect artistic creation with scientific understanding, offering a blended learning experience. Frequently Asked Questions
The following addresses common inquiries regarding illustrative sheets featuring extinct animals, designed for coloring.
Question 1: What types of animals are typically represented on these coloring sheets?
The illustrations predominantly feature dinosaurs, such as Tyrannosaurus Rex, Triceratops, and Stegosaurus. However, depictions of early mammals, prehistoric marine reptiles (e.g., Plesiosaurs), and ancient insects may also be included.
Question 2: Are these coloring sheets suitable for all age groups?
While the activity itself is generally safe for all ages, the complexity of the illustrations can vary. Simpler outlines are recommended for younger children, whereas older children and adults may prefer more detailed and intricate designs.
Question 3: Is there any scientific basis for the colors chosen on these sheets?
The coloration depicted on these sheets is often based on artistic interpretation, as the actual colors of many prehistoric animals are unknown. Paleontologists use fossil evidence and comparative anatomy to infer potential color patterns, but definitive color schemes are speculative.
Question 4: Where can these coloring sheets be obtained?
These materials are widely available online through educational websites, museums, and digital marketplaces. Printable versions can often be downloaded for free, while physical coloring books can be purchased from various retailers.
Question 5: What are the educational benefits of using these coloring sheets?
They can enhance fine motor skills, stimulate creativity, and introduce learners to the field of paleontology. Furthermore, they can encourage research into the specific animals depicted, promoting a deeper understanding of prehistoric life.
Question 6: Are there any safety concerns associated with these materials?
The primary concern is the safety of coloring implements, such as crayons or markers. Ensure that these materials are non-toxic, especially when used by young children. Proper supervision is recommended to prevent ingestion or misuse of coloring supplies.

Guidance for Utilizing Prehistoric Creature Coloring Pages
This section provides a structured approach for maximizing the educational and recreational value of illustrative sheets for coloring, featuring extinct animals.
Tip 1: Prioritize Accuracy of Depiction: When selecting materials, favor illustrations that adhere to current paleontological understanding of skeletal structure and physical features. This reinforces accurate visual learning.
Tip 2: Integrate Supplementary Research: Supplement the coloring activity with research into the depicted species. Investigate habitat, diet, and known behaviors to enrich the learning experience.
Tip 3: Encourage Experimentation with Color Theory: While actual coloration is often unknown, explore potential camouflage strategies or display patterns based on analogous modern species. This promotes critical thinking and creative problem-solving.
Tip 4: Utilize Varied Media: Experiment with different coloring tools, such as colored pencils, crayons, or watercolor paints, to enhance artistic expression and develop diverse artistic techniques.
Tip 5: Emphasize Anatomical Details: Use the coloring activity as an opportunity to highlight and label anatomical features, such as skeletal structures, muscle groups, and integumentary coverings. This strengthens comprehension of animal morphology.
Tip 6: Promote Comparative Analysis: Compare and contrast the features of different prehistoric animals featured on the coloring sheets, fostering an understanding of evolutionary relationships and adaptations.
Tip 7: Adapt Complexity to Age Appropriateness: Select designs and detail level that matches the users fine motor skills. Use simple, large designs for small children and more complex detail for older children and adults.
Adherence to these guidelines maximizes the utility of prehistoric creature coloring pages as both educational tools and creative outlets. It transforms a simple activity into an engaging exploration of paleontology, art, and scientific inquiry.
